How do you get to Poseidon on Mythology Island?

You can enter the realm of Poseidon from his temple at the far right of the island. Use the starfish (from Poseidon's statue in the museum) as an offering on the altar. To get to the throne room (except as a glitch), you will need Hercules. Hercules will not help you until you have returned all of the 5 sacred items to the Tree of Immortality. Get the Touchscreen Mirror from Aphrodite on Poseidon's beach, so that you can transport Hercules to the realms of Poseidon and Hades (he does not like to walk).

Is Poseidon and Zeus brothers?

Yes, Poseidon and Zeus are brothers in Greek mythology. They are two of the three main gods, with their sibling Hades completing the trio. Zeus is the god of the sky and ruler of Mount Olympus, while Poseidon is the god of the sea. Their relationship is characterized by both cooperation and rivalry, as they each govern different realms.

Who were posiedons brothers?

Poseidon's brothers are Zeus and Hades. In Greek mythology, they are the three principal gods of the Olympian pantheon, with Zeus ruling the sky, Poseidon governing the sea, and Hades overseeing the underworld. After defeating the Titans, they divided the realms among themselves, with Poseidon receiving control of the oceans. Each brother held significant power and responsibility within their respective domains.
